Output e3986708a68a31782b7a19966c41c7c7cc8379978e611a7b0e903881c670a420:3

value
678
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 27a260d0b05e946ea3a5d190f5428e46e12bda366b58cb95fd2b30e4f6b3b234
address
bc1py73xp59st62xaga96xg02s5wgmsjhk3kddvvh90a9vcwfa4nkg6qcvrwrm
transaction
e3986708a68a31782b7a19966c41c7c7cc8379978e611a7b0e903881c670a420
confirmations
20886
spent
true